What causes damp and mould?

Damp and mould is caused by condensation, which is when excess warm moisture in the air like steam or water vapour meets a cold surface and turns into water. Over time, this can cause patches of damp or mould to form. This can be more common in rooms with poor ventilation or insulation, which can make it more difficult to treat. There are often other factors at play in creating damp and mould, which is why it is important to investigate it as soon as possible.
